How to Make Credit Cards Work For You

When credit cards are used responsibly they can be some of the best tools in your financial toolbox. In fact, if you know what you are doing you can really make credit cards work for you. They can earn you everything from air miles to free clothes if you use them correctly. 

What you can get

The possibilities are endless. You can get airline miles, which can be used for traveling with your family. You can get cash back on your purchases, sometimes up to 5%. You can get rewards such as gift certificates to stores and restaurants. You can actually save a lot of money on travel, gifts, and even get cash back with these cards.

There is a catch

There, however, is a catch. In most cases you must pay your balances off every month in order to be able to receive the rewards. For example, if you have a cash back rewards card, they typically issue checks twice a year, if your balance has been paid. So if you spent two thousand dollars, on a 5% cash back rewards card, you can get $100 dollars back, if your balance is zero when they go to cut the check. Miles also, can often not be redeemed if you have a balance. 

A way to beat this 

There is an easy way to make this work for you. Don't buy anything you don't need. Many people wonder then, how do you earn enough of your rewards? Well let’s say you are planning a Disney World vacation a year from now. So you get a credit card with Disney rewards that give you 5% cash back on all your purchases. So instead of buying a bunch of random stuff that you don't need put all your bills and groceries on it every month. You already know you can pay it off. So every month you put $1000 dollars on it and pay it off at the end of every month. At the end of the year that’s $600 dollars to put towards your vacation and you are not in any debt!
